#560796 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#560796 is composed of 33.7% red, 2.7% green and 58.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 42.7% cyan, 95.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 41.2% black. It has a hue angle of 273.1 degrees, a saturation of 91.1% and a lightness of 30.8%. #560796 color hex could be obtained by blending #ac0eff with #00002d.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

#560796 color description : Dark violet.

#560796 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#560796 has RGB values of R:86, G:7, B:150 and CMYK values of C:0.43,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.41. Its decimal value is 5638038.

Shades and Tints of #560796

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f6ecf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#560796

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4f4954 is the less saturated color, while #57019c is the most saturated one.
